AI technology has the potential to transform the way sales training is conducted by providing personalized, data-driven insights and feedback to sales reps. Traditional training methods often involve generic one-size-fits-all approaches that may not be tailored to individual learning styles or needs. AI, on the other hand, can analyze vast amounts of data to identify patterns and trends, enabling sales trainers to create more targeted and relevant training programs.

One of the key benefits of using AI in sales training is its ability to provide real-time feedback to sales reps. AI-powered tools can track sales reps’ performance during training sessions, identify areas for improvement, and provide immediate feedback on how to enhance their skills. This instant feedback loop can help sales reps learn and improve more quickly, leading to better results in the field.

AI can also help sales trainers identify high-potential sales reps and tailor training programs to meet their specific needs. By analyzing performance data and assessing the strengths and weaknesses of individual sales reps, AI can create personalized learning paths that focus on areas where each rep needs the most help. This targeted approach can lead to more effective training outcomes and ultimately drive better sales results.

Another way AI is revolutionizing sales training is through the use of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ies. These immersive technologies can simulate real-life sales scenarios, allowing sales reps to practice their skills in a safe and controlled environment. By using VR and AR, sales reps can gain hands-on experience and build confidence before interacting with actual customers, leading to better sales performance in the field.

AI-powered chatbots are also being used in sales training to provide interactive learning experiences for sales reps. These chatbots can answer questions, provide guidance, and simulate customer interactions, allowing sales reps to practice their communication skills in a realistic setting. By incorporating AI chatbots into sales training programs, organizations can enhance the learning experience for sales reps and improve their overall performance.

In addition to improving sales reps’ skills, AI can also help sales trainers optimize training content and delivery methods. By analyzing data on training effectiveness, AI can provide insights into which training materials are most effective, which methods are most engaging, and which topics need to be covered in more detail. This data-driven approach can enable sales trainers to continuously refine and improve their training programs, leading to better outcomes for sales teams.

Furthermore, AI can help sales organizations track and measure the impact of their training efforts. By analyzing data on sales performance before and after training, AI can prov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of training programs and identify areas for improvement. This data-driven approach can help sales organizations make more informed decisions about training investments and allocate resources more effectively.
